Iran warns U.S. energy assets in Gulf are vulnerable after latest clashes

Iran threatened on Monday (September 7, 2026) to retaliate against any new U.S. attacks on its assets, warning that energy infrastructure across the Gulf, including U.S. oil and ‌gas interests, was vulnerable. “Strike our assets and you get struck,” Iranian Parliament Speaker Mohammad Baqer Qalibaf said after ​U.S. and Iranian strikes on shipping at the…
